When to Call an Emergency Electrician

Electrical emergencies don’t adhere to a 9-to-5 schedule. They can strike at any moment, often at the most inconvenient times. Recognizing the signs of a serious electrical problem is the first step in ensuring a swift and effective resolution. Common scenarios that necessitate an immediate call to an emergency electrician include:

  • Sudden and complete power outages affecting your entire home or business.
  • Sparks or arcing coming from outlets, switches, or electrical panels.
  • Burning smells originating from electrical fixtures or appliances.
  • Frequent tripping of circuit breakers or blowing of fuses.
  • Flickering lights that persist despite testing light bulbs.
  • Visible damage to electrical wiring or components.
  • A buzzing or humming sound emanating from your electrical panel.

What an Emergency Electrician in Torrington Does

When you contact an emergency electrician in Torrington, you can expect a prompt response from a qualified professional prepared to diagnose and resolve your electrical crisis. The process typically involves several key stages:

Upon receiving your call, the electrician will gather essential information about the issue and your location within Torrington. They will then dispatch a technician who will travel to your property, often equipped with specialized tools and diagnostic equipment. Upon arrival, the electrician will conduct a thorough assessment of the problem, prioritizing safety above all else. This might involve:

  • Using voltage testers and multimeters to identify the source of the fault.
  • Inspecting your main electrical panel for signs of damage, overload, or faulty breakers.
  • Examining outlets, switches, and light fixtures for wear and tear or loose connections.
  • Tracing wiring to pinpoint breaks or short circuits.

Once the issue is identified, the emergency electrician will explain the problem to you in clear terms, outline the necessary repairs, and provide an estimate for the work. They are trained to handle a wide array of urgent electrical situations, including:

  • Restoring power during an outage.
  • Repairing or replacing faulty circuit breakers.
  • Addressing wiring shorts and open circuits.
  • Fixing problems with overloaded circuits.
  • Emergency lighting repairs.
  • Dangerous situations involving exposed wiring or electrical fires.

In many cases, the electrician will have the necessary parts on hand to complete immediate repairs, minimizing downtime for your home or business. For more extensive issues, they will explain the next steps and schedule a follow-up appointment for a permanent solution.

Frequently Asked Questions About Emergency Electricians in Torrington

Q1: My power is out in my Torrington home. Should I call an emergency electrician immediately?

First, check your main utility company’s outage map or call them to see if there’s a widespread outage in the Torrington area. If your neighbors have power and only your home is affected, then it’s time to call an emergency electrician. They can quickly determine if the issue is with your internal wiring, electrical panel, or a problem with the connection to your home.

Q3: If I experience flickering lights, is it always an emergency that requires an immediate visit?

While minor flickering can sometimes be resolved by changing a lightbulb, persistent or severe flickering across multiple fixtures, or flickering that coincides with other electrical issues like unusual smells or tripping breakers, should be treated as a potential emergency. It could indicate a loose connection, an overloaded circuit, or even a more serious wiring problem, all of which warrant a prompt professional assessment from an emergency electrician in Torrington.

Local Electrical Age Data for Torrington

The median home in Torrington was built in 1960 — placing most of the area's housing stock in the possible aluminum branch wiring era. Aluminum branch-circuit wiring was widely installed in homes built during the 1965–1973 period as a cost-saving alternative to copper. Aluminum expands and contracts more than copper, loosening connections over time and creating arc-fault fire hazards. Affected homes require either full rewiring or approved remediation at every device (AFCI breakers or CO/ALR-rated outlets and switches).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ey, median year structure built.

Do I need a permit for Emergency Electrician in Connecticut?

In Connecticut, permits are generally required for panel upgrades, new circuits, rewiring, and any work that changes the electrical system's structure. A licensed electrician will pull the permit as part of the job. Unpermitted electrical work can create insurance issues and complicate a future home sale.
